Description
Students often need help learning to write well. This book serves as a student text and a resource for implementing a mathematics research program. The book details how to write a research paper, from pre-writing to presenting the paper. It provides interesting research topics, a bibliography of periodicals and problem-solving books and information about mathematics contests.

Content
Introduction; Chapter 1: Mathematics: Shouting Questions and Whispering Answers; Chapter 2: Problem Solving: A Prerequisite for Research; Chapter 3: Writing Mathematics; Chapter 4: The Math Annotation Project; Chapter 5: Conjectures, Theorems, and Proofs; Chapter 6: Finding a Topic; Chapter 7: Reading and Keeping a Research Journal; Chapter 8: Components of Your Research Paper; Chapter 9: Oral Presentations; Chapter 10: After Your First Research Paper; Appendix A: Resources; Appendix B: Sample Pages from Students' Research Papers; Appendix C: A Guide for Instructors and Administrators; References
